1,将tailwind的引入放在element-plus/dist/index.css前面。我的tailwind是在App.vue里引入的,所以把import App from './App.vue'放在了import 'elemnt-plus/dist.index.css'前面。看个人的文件位置调整引入顺序就好。 2.然后找到一个叫tailwind.config.js的文件。找到里面的plugins:[] 改成: plugins:[ funcion(...
// 单独引入ElMessageBoximport{ElMessageBox}from'element-plus'// 单独引入样式即可import'element-plus/es/components/message-box/style'
你好 这是element-plus V2 之后的样式发生了变化导致的,可以参考下课程 13 章中升级的内容。 0 回复 相似问题下载element-plus/icons报错 2907 1 7 老师我的侧边栏,跟着您的代码写 为啥展示的不一样呢 641 2 8 element-plus 2.0.2版本 按钮有内联样式,导致更新主题不起作用 1213 0 2 关于Element-...
Reproduction Link Link Steps to reproduce 使用自动导入的方式使用 elementPlus API 组件想要通过 SCSS 变量自定义主题必须自定义命名空间否则会造成自定义样式失效的问题 并且自定义命名空间会导致无用的 el 命名空间的变量重复打包,导致最终构建产物体积增加 通过手动引入相关 API 组件可解决此问题 What is Expected?
[Style] [message] 使用 unplugin-auto-import 和 unplugin-vue-components 自动引入时,Elmessage样式丢失,或使 sass 自定义主题失效 #15717 Closed polarove opened this issue Jan 30, 2024· 4 comments Comments polarove commented Jan 30, 2024 Bug Type: Style Environment Vue Version: 3.4.15 ...
1 前言 1.1 目的 Element Plus 使用按需引入,大大缩小打包后的文件大小 1.2 最终效果 自动生成 components.d.ts 文件,并在文件中引入 E...
看到网上一些解决方法是在main.ts再引入一遍,像这样 import "element-plus/theme-chalk/el-message.css"; import "element-plus/theme-chalk/el-message-box.css"; 其实只需要重启一遍就可以了,auto-imports.d.ts会多出如下代码 export {} declare global { const ElMessage: typeof import('element-plus/es...
按需引入目前的情况是正如上面猜测的一样 unplugin-auto-import 是没用的,只用到了 unplugin-vue-components,而且只有在ts模式下才会生成 auto-imports.d.ts、components.d.ts 这两个文件 按需引入还必须在 main.ts 中引入样式,即 import 'element-plus/dist/index.css',否则弹框等样式失效...
"postcss-preset-env", // 能解决大多数样式兼容性问题 ], }, }, }, preProcessor && { loader: preProcessor, options: preProcessor === "sass-loader" ? { // 自定义主题:自动引入我们定义的scss文件 --@是路径别名需要配置 additionalData: `@use "@/styles/element/index.scss" as *;`, ...